How do Salisbury pet spas handle the removal of salt and sand from my dog's coat after a trip to the beach?

Most Salisbury pet spas are experts at post-beach grooming. They typically use a thorough pre-bath brushing to remove loose sand, followed by a de-shedding treatment and a high-velocity dryer to blast out remaining particles. They often finish with a moisturizing conditioner to combat the drying effects of salt water, leaving your pet's coat clean and healthy.

Do any local pet spas offer specialized de-skunking treatments, which might be needed after encounters with wildlife near the Salisbury Marsh or Plum Island?

Absolutely. Several Salisbury-area groomers offer emergency de-skunking services, as skunks are common in the marsh and woodland habitats. These treatments use professional-grade, neutralizing formulas that are far more effective than homemade tomato juice remedies. It's best to call the spa ahead of your arrival so they can prepare for your pet's immediate treatment.

What specific grooming considerations do local spas have for breeds like Newfoundlands or Huskies, given Salisbury's humid summers and cold, snowy winters?

Salisbury groomers are experienced with double-coated breeds. For summer, they focus on a thorough de-shedding service to remove the dense undercoat, which significantly helps with temperature regulation and prevents matting. In preparation for winter, they advise against shaving and instead recommend a hygienic trim and a good brush-out to maintain the coat's natural insulating properties against the coastal cold and wind.
